body {
font:10pt/1.5 georgia, 'times new roman', serif;
margin:1em;
color:black;
}

p {
margin:1em 0;
}

a {
color:black;

}

.img-right {
float:right;
margin:8px 0 8px 8px;
}

.img-left {
float:left;
margin:8px 8px 8px 0;
}

#content #main-content .img-right a,
#content #main-content .img-left a,
#content #main-content .img-center a,
#content #main-content .img-right a:hover,
#content #main-content .img-left a:hover,
#content #main-content .img-center a:hover {
border-style:none;
}

.img-landscape {
width:248px;
}

.img-portrait {
width:168px;
}

.img-right img,
.img-left img,
.img-centre img {
display:block;
border:1px solid #ccc;
padding:4px;
}

p.caption {
line-height:1.2em;
font-size:.8em;
text-align:center;
margin:8px 0;
color:#666;
}


#sidebar-b {
display:none;
}

h2 {
font:14pt helvetica, verdana, arial, sans-serif;
}

p.date {
font-variant: small-caps;
}

#header {
border-bottom:2pt solid black;
padding-bottom:10pt;
}

#header a#schoolbag-logo {
display:block;
font:24pt helvetica, verdana, arial, sans-serif;
}

#header #main-nav {
font-size:12pt;
}

#header #func-nav {
float:right;
}

#header a {
text-decoration:none;
}

#header #func-nav {
display:none;
}

#content {
margin:30pt 0;
}

#footer {
text-align:right;
border-top:1px solid #ccc;
padding:10pt 0;
}